    Hello Guys, I'm a South African graduate in Film and Animation and as the title of this thread points out. I'm planning on making an original animated Superman fan film. Like many of you, i'm saddened to see the lack of attention, good representation and respect given to Superman and id like to try and turn that around for the character. I'm already in the process of planning a Superman and Zootopia Crossover fanfic that I'm hoping to turn into a fan comic. But being a student in Animation, id like to do this aswell. My objective is to create a fan film that showcases the best and most appealing qualities about the character.

    I'm thinking of going with something along the lines of All Star Superman, minus the spiral towards death aspect. The film would look into a day in the life of Clark kent as he juggles his work life with his responsibilities as superman. It would be set in either the post crisis or pre bendis dc rebirth timeline where Clark is married to lois and jon is around. Although, they may not appear in the short as I want to focus on Supes. There would be other characters that would appear in the film, some of my own creation. Alot of action, Drama, Comedy and emotional storytelling and 3d animated. So far I am only in the pre production planning stage of the project and doing it on my own with no idea of how long the film will be or when I will eventually complete the project. Plus, i'm still a very amateur fresh graduate, however i'm not letting that stop me.

    Right now, id like to get some advice on the film. What ideas, elements and plot points I can incorporate, are there any comics i can read to get insight into and take inspiration from. Are there any underrated Superman villians or characters you'd like to recommend me to use. Id appreciate any and every piece of advice you guys can give as it would be very helpful.

    Okay, so cosmic Superman, and twelve great feats. Very Herculean, I like it.

    I assume taking out an alien fleet is one of the feats, so what else can the guy do?

    Not to tell you your business, but I find it more impressive when Clark combines his intellect and mental capabilities with his raw physical might. It's more fun than just punching harder than the other guy. So thinks like multi-tasking, doing complex calculations in a fight, stuff like that.

    A few suggestions might be:

    Dealing with a hostile environment, like the heart of a star, nebula, center of a planet, or just surrounded by angry aliens/monsters, and trying to procure and then protect a delicate and rare substance he needs to create a solution to a "non-punchable" problem; like a cure for a disease or renewable green energy source.

    Negotiating a peace treaty between two warring factions with wildly different ethics; perhaps one are pacifists while the others are tyrants or something. Make Superman punch the tyrants harder than they can punch back without losing the trust of the pacifists. Alternatively, doing the same thing between factions that don't even recognize each other; maybe there's a microscopic race living in a forest and Superman has to stop loggers from cutting the forest down and stop the microscopic race from infesting the loggers, or something along those lines.

    And two things that you can never go wrong with in a Superman story; Clark connecting on a personal, emotional level with a child, and Superman in a no-holds barred fight against a superior foe.

    On the Clark side of things....you could have him investigating some shady person/group like Intergang or whoever, get caught, shot in the shoulder, and Clark has to escape with the evidence while pretending he's hurt so he doesn't give his identity away.

    You can also put him into an investigation where his powers aren't helpful; say there's a bombing but all the chemicals and other materials used are so common being able to detect them with his enhanced senses doesn't help solve the "who dunnit?" Like the bomb is made of common household chemicals; being able to see and smell them doesn't help him find out who did it or where they are.

    Or someone has figured out that Clark is Superman, and Clark has to prove them wrong. Like Lois has figured it out and is close to proving it and Clark has to throw the evidence chain off so nobody will believe the claim.

    I think animation would be perfect to explore the way he sees the world with his supervisions. Superman can see atoms, virus mutating on the air or in someone's bloodstream or spectrums of light that normal people can't or even things that we don't know exists.

    So I think you would strike gold by doing a really crazy scene where the audience would see through Superman's eyes.

    But the most important is for you to tell a great story featuring Superman, my main problem with how the character is treated is that DC and many creators appear to be only interested on him in a meta level, they want to tell stories about what Superman represent not about the character.
